LATEST: One Patient Dies, Bringing Death Toll Rises To 21

The Covid-19 death toll has increased to 21. This follows the death of a 63-year-old patient earlier today.

Health director-general Datuk Dr Noor Hisham Abdullah said the septuagenarian’s death was reported to the National Crisis Preparedness and Response Centre.

Noor Hisham said the victim, a local, was Case 1588.

“He had participated in the tabligh gathering at Masjid Jamek Seri Petaling. He was treated at the Sultanah Bahiyah Hospital, Kedah on 23 March.

“He died at 4.00 am today,” said Noor Hisham in a statement.
